Kayleigh McEnany Slams Jean-Pierre over ‘the Volcanic Vesuvian Magnitude of Her Lie’ about Border

Kayleigh McEnany has slammed White House Press Secretary Karine Jean-Pierre for claiming that the Biden administration has done more to secure the border than President Donald Trump did.

McEnany, President Trump’s former White House press secretary, fired back at Jean-Pierre over “her lie.”

“I’m going to quote someone who has a way with words,” McEnany said on her hit Fox News show “Outnumbered.”

“And it’s my former colleague, Stephen Miller, who to that point said this: ‘Human vocabulary is inadequate to convey the volcanic Vesuvian magnitude of her lie.’

“And I don’t use that word lightly, but I use it here because to say that you have done more to secure the border, the natural follow-up is what have you done Joe Biden?

“You left as a rotting pile, border supplies that should have been used to build the wall.

“We’ve all seen the pictures of those materials just sitting there wasting away.

“You rolled back Remain in Mexico,” she noted.

“Oh, yeah. You did that to secure the border?

“You didn’t work with the Mexican government who called you the migrant president to bring troops there to the southern border like President Trump did.

“And you’re trying to roll back Title 42.

“You have not done one thing to secure this border, and that talking point, I don’t use the word lie lightly, but I use it in response to that because that’s very evidently what that is,” she said.
